gcl-devel
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: Support of macOS at the last master


From: Kirill A. Korinsky
Subject: Re: Support of macOS at the last master
Date: Tue, 1 Aug 2023 09:52:32 +0200

After commenting a target at gcl/h/386-macosx.defs it loads but crashes as:

/Users/catap/src/gcl/gcl/unixport/raw_pre_gcl /Users/catap/src/gcl/gcl/unixport/ -libdir /Users/catap/src/gcl/gcl/ < foo
GCL (GNU Common Lisp)  April 1994  9489691 pages
Building symbol table for /Users/catap/src/gcl/gcl/unixport/raw_pre_gcl ..
Segmentation violation: c stack ok:signalling error
Unrecoverable error: Segmentation violation..
/bin/sh: line 1:  3729 Abort trap: 6           /Users/catap/src/gcl/gcl/unixport/raw_pre_gcl /Users/catap/src/gcl/gcl/unixport/ -libdir /Users/catap/src/gcl/gcl/ < foo
make[1]: *** [saved_pre_gcl] Error 134

and stack trace looks like:

Crashed Thread:        0  Dispatch queue: com.apple.main-thread

Exception Type:        EXC_BAD_ACCESS (SIGABRT)
Exception Codes:       KERN_INVALID_ADDRESS at 0x0000000000000000
Exception Codes:       0x0000000000000001, 0x0000000000000000
Exception Note:        EXC_CORPSE_NOTIFY

VM Region Info: 0 is not in any region.  Bytes before following region: 4294967296
      REGION TYPE                    START - END         [ VSIZE] PRT/MAX SHRMOD  REGION DETAIL
      UNUSED SPACE AT START
--->  
      __TEXT                      100000000-1000e0000    [  896K] r-x/r-x SM=COW  ...*/raw_pre_gcl

Application Specific Information:
abort() called


Thread 0 Crashed::  Dispatch queue: com.apple.main-thread
0   libsystem_kernel.dylib             0x7ff80bb57ffe __pthread_kill + 10
1   libsystem_pthread.dylib            0x7ff80bb8e1ff pthread_kill + 263
2   libsystem_c.dylib                  0x7ff80bad9d24 abort + 123
3   raw_pre_gcl                           0x10006a010 error + 400
4   ???                                           0x0 ???
5   libsystem_c.dylib                  0x7ff80ba8cbec _qsort + 282
6   raw_pre_gcl                           0x1000b920b build_symbol_table + 1307


Thread 0 crashed with X86 Thread State (64-bit):
  rax: 0x0000000000000000  rbx: 0x000000010cce2600  rcx: 0x0000000102414ea8  rdx: 0x0000000000000000
  rdi: 0x0000000000000103  rsi: 0x0000000000000006  rbp: 0x0000000102414ed0  rsp: 0x0000000102414ea8
   r8: 0x00007ff84d2e1bc8   r9: 0x0000000000000000  r10: 0x0000000000000000  r11: 0x0000000000000246
  r12: 0x0000000000000103  r13: 0x00000001000b9380  r14: 0x0000000000000006  r15: 0x0000000000000016
  rip: 0x00007ff80bb57ffe  rfl: 0x0000000000000246  cr2: 0x0000000102414ff8
  
Logical CPU:     0
Error Code:      0x02000148 
Trap Number:     133

Thread 0 instruction stream:
  66 0f 6f 04 0f f3 0f 6f-0c 0e 66 0f 74 c1 66 0f  f.o....o..f.t.f.
  74 ca 66 0f df c8 66 0f-d7 c1 48 83 c1 10 3d ff  t.f...f...H...=.
  ff 00 00 75 60 4c 39 c9-75 d6 4c 01 cf 4c 01 ce  ...u`L9.u.L..L..
  48 31 c9 48 0f b6 07 4c-0f b6 06 48 ff c7 48 ff  H1.H...L...H..H.
  c6 4c 29 c0 75 95 4d 85-c0 74 90 48 f7 c7 0f 00  .L).u.M..t.H....
  00 00 75 df 49 c7 c1 f0-0f 00 00 eb a3 0f 1f 00  ..u.I...........
 [66]0f 6f 04 0f f3 0f 6f-0c 0e 66 0f 74 c1 66 0f  f.o....o..f.t.f. <==
  74 ca 66 0f df c8 66 0f-d7 c1 48 83 c1 10 3d ff  t.f...f...H...=.
  ff 00 00 74 db f7 d0 0f-bc c0 48 01 c1 48 0f b6  ...t......H..H..
  44 0f f0 4c 0f b6 44 0e-f0 4c 29 c0 5d c3 90 90  D..L..D..L).]...
  90 90 90 90 90 90 90 90-90 90 90 90 90 90 90 90  ................
  55 48 89 e5 49 89 fb 49-29 f3 48 89 f8 49 39 d3  UH..I..I).H..I9.

Binary Images:
    0x7ff80bb50000 -     0x7ff80bb87fff libsystem_kernel.dylib (*) <5e9789af-5bca-3e41-a07a-c2dcc3180ea3> /usr/lib/system/libsystem_kernel.dylib
    0x7ff80bb88000 -     0x7ff80bb93fff libsystem_pthread.dylib (*) <e5d44afd-2577-3cee-8711-9d8d426229e0> /usr/lib/system/libsystem_pthread.dylib
    0x7ff80ba58000 -     0x7ff80bae0fff libsystem_c.dylib (*) <e42e9d7a-03b4-340b-b61e-dcd45fd4acc0> /usr/lib/system/libsystem_c.dylib
       0x100000000 -        0x1000dffff raw_pre_gcl (*) <c0e63f4a-27ed-3024-8882-864e932580c3> /Users/USER/*/raw_pre_gcl
               0x0 - 0xffffffffffffffff ??? (*) <00000000-0000-0000-0000-000000000000> ???

-- 
wbr, Kirill

Attachment: signature.asc
Description: Message signed with OpenPGP


reply via email to

[Prev in Thread] Current Thread [Next in Thread]